The Lanaudière Biofood Development Council (CDBL) is a non-profit organization that serves as the regional coordination table for the biofood sector of Lanaudière (Québec) Since 1991, it has actively supported producers, processors, and companies in marketing, promotion, product and process innovation, technology transfer, and the development of sustainable business relationships. CDBL coordinates major regional projects, organizes campaigns such as Goûtez Lanaudière!, and provides tools and resources to facilitate market access, while fostering collaboration, knowledge sharing, innovation, and strengthening the overall competitiveness, growth, and vitality of the Lanaudière biofood sector.
